KING GEORGE THE FIFTH MEMORIAL FUND BOARD (ANNUAL REPORT AND STATEMENT OF ACCOUNTS OF THE) FOR THE PERIOD 14th SEPTEMBER, 1938, TO 31st MARCH, 1940.

Presented in 'pursuance of Section 19 of the King George the Fifth Memorial Fund Act, 1938.

During the year ended the 31st March, 1940, the King George the Fifth Memorial Fund Board held two meetings at which questions relating to the establishment, improvement, and maintenance of children's health camps were dealt with. Under the authority conferred by the King George the Fifth Memorial Fund Act, 1938, the Board authorized expenditure from the Capital Fund at the under-mentioned locations:— Otaki Health Camp— £ s. d. Representations were made to the Board to have the word " exclusively " deleted from section 2 of the King George the Fifth Fund Act. The Board decided that the Act did not need amending, as the Board is already empowered to make grants for general purposes of a capital nature to all permanent camps (though the same may not be main camps), provided they are children's health camps within the meaning of the Act and are situate on lands which are the property of the local health camp executive or are vested in the Board. The ultimate aim of the Board is to provide health-camp facilities throughout the Dominion and thus ensure that those children who are in need of health-camp treatment are catered for.
